Teacher – SPED Alternative Academics (AA) Lifeskills (Secondary) 2026-27 Clear Creek ISD DISTRICT-WIDE - League City, Texas Open in Google Maps This job is also posted in Clear Creek ISD Job Details Application Deadline: Jan 31, 2027 11:59 PM (Central Standard Time) Starting Date: To Be Determined Job Description Primary Purpose Provide all students with appropriate learning experiences designed to help them fulfill their potential for intellectual, emotional, physical, and social growth; enable students to develop competencies and skills to function as successful, productive, contributing members of our society. Actively engage in actions that contribute to the overall mission and strategic plan of Clear Creek ISD. Qualifications Education/Certification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university Valid Texas certificate for the subject and level assigned Special Knowledge/Skills Positive and productive communication and interpersonal skills Knowledge and demonstrated competency in the subject(s) assigned General knowledge of curriculum and instruction Specific Knowledge of special needs of students in assigned area Knowledge of Admission, Review, and Dismissal (ARD) Committee process and Individual Education Plan (IEP) goal setting process and implementation In depth knowledge of behavior principles and strategies to include ABA Ability to incorporate behavior principles in positive, proactive, and instructional ways Knowledge of positive behavior supports and crisis interventions Flexibility to change; innovation to meet the needs of all students General knowledge of objective data collection and interpretation Experience At least one year student teaching or approved internship Major Responsibilities and Duties Guide the learning of students in accordance with the district’s philosophy of instruction toward the achievement of curriculum goals.
